Vibrational analysis of curved single-walled carbon nanotube on a Pasternak elastic foundation

Advances in Engineering Software, 2012
Continuum mechanics and an elastic beam model were employed in the nonlinear force vibrational analysis of an embedded, curved, single-walled carbon nanotube. The analysis considered the effects of the curvature or waviness and midplane stretching of the nanotube on the nonlinear frequency.
